Seaport

Dive into Boston’s contemporary side with a summer visit to the Seaport. This waterfront gem is alive with energy, offering everything from cutting-edge art at the Institute of Contemporary Art to refreshing breezes along the Harborwalk. Treat yourself to a seafood feast at Row 34 or enjoy a creative cocktails at Vela.

Downtown & The Theater District

Downtown and the Theater District are perfect destinations for summertime exploration. Visit historic Boston Common or catch a top-tier performance at the Boston Opera House. Wander cobblestone streets to discover chic boutiques, dine al fresco at gourmet restaurants, and immerse yourself in the Boston nightlife. Here, the past and present blend seamlessly, offering endless summer fun.

Cambridge

Cross the river into Cambridge, where summer is all about exploration and discovery.  Canoe or kayak on the Charles River. Catch one of the summer’s many outdoor concerts at Danehy Park or a Screen on the Green outdoor  movie night. From Harvard Square’s bustling streets to laid-back afternoons along the Charles River Esplanade, Cambridge offers endless summer activities and endless moments waiting to become lifelong memories.

Back Bay

Back Bay is unforgettable with its iconic brownstone-lined streets and upscale shopping on Newbury Street. Take a leisurely walk through the blooming Public Garden or marvel at the historic architecture of Copley Square. With its mix of high-end fashion, art galleries, and gourmet dining, Back Bay is the epitome of Boston’s timeless allure during the sunny months.

North End

Boston’s historic North End is perfect for a delicious culinary adventure, from classic cannoli to innovative Italian dishes at local favorites like Giulia. Explore the Freedom Trail and visit landmarks like Paul Revere’s House, then relax along the scenic waterfront. In North End, summer is a feast for the senses, rich with history and vibrant culture.

Greater Boston Metro

Beyond the city limits, the Boston region reveals more to explore. In Medford, enjoy a serene day at the Mystic River Reservation, perfect for hiking, kayaking, and picnicking. Newton boasts the beautiful Chestnut Hill Reservoir, as well as the Newton Centre for delightful dining and shopping options. A short drive away, discover the scenic beauty of the Middlesex Fells Reservation and the vibrant cultural scene in Arlington and Waltham.

Brookline & Cleveland Circle

Escape to the leafy neighborhoods of Brookline and Cleveland Circle for a summer retreat within the city. Take in the charm of Coolidge Corner’s independent shops and cozy cafes, or unwind in the lush expanses of Olmsted Park. Visit the John F. Kennedy National Historic Site or enjoy the lively, youthful energy of Cleveland Circle’s casual eateries and pubs. This suburban oasis offers a tranquil yet vibrant summer experience.
